SEC’s Atkins Sees Crypto Work With CFTC as ‘Job No. 1 Right Now’

Sept. 29, 2025, 8:02 PM UTC

Coordinating cryptocurrency rules is the top task for key Wall Street regulators, US Securities and Exchange Commission Chair Paul Atkins said Monday.

“Crypto is job No. 1 right now,” Atkins told reporters after a meeting between SEC and US Commodity Futures Trading Commission leadership focusing on areas where the two agencies can work together. The regulators have also called out prediction markets, perpetual futures, and 24/7 trading as areas ripe for agency coordination.
